Following York RR I promised to do some calcs about intercoolers. Without the boring detail and depending on the circumstances it would be possible to lose up to 25% power in the case of no cooling at all at 1.4 bar boost (I'm sure the 134degC inlet temperature (70% compressor efficiency) would cause the ppp ECU to back things off as well). There must be some convection with the bonnet open on a RR and surprisingly little flow is needed to get almost sufficient cooling - say the eqivalent of 5 mph air flow in the cooler - maybe only 10 mph on the road, bottom line is that results can be very hit and miss in these circumstances so If you were 40bhp down just blame it on the unrealistic lack of cooling.
